Output e1d40981b6620a5368db15829435354ac9305248f1daba864457a630b88118a2:0

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d695826b1ea4c10d150eafc8be01b9bf2db5cb70 OP_EQUAL
address
3MFddhCjBS43CEG1XK2Qyq1YJBUC416q6L
transaction
e1d40981b6620a5368db15829435354ac9305248f1daba864457a630b88118a2
spent
true